Dr. Cyril conducts a simple random sample of 500 men who became fathers for the first time in the past year. He finds that 23% o
svlad2 [7]

Answer:

The another term for the 4% value is : Margin of error

Step-by-step explanation:

Dr. Cyril conducts a simple random sample of 500 men.

He finds that 23% of them report being unsure of their ability to be good fathers, plus or minus 4%.

Now, the another term for the 4% value is : Margin of error

Means the estimate of father being unsure about his ability would be between 19% and 27%.

When sample size is increased, the margin of error becomes smaller.

In the data set below, what is the variance? 9 8 9 5 9 If the answer is a decimal, round it to the nearest tenth. variance (σ2):
victus00 [196]

Answer:

2.4

Step-by-step explanation:

We would first calculate the mean, because we would need it to calculate our varance.

Mean= sum of the number of given data set/ total number

Mean = (9 +8 +9 +5 +9 )/5

= 40/5= 8

variance (σ2):= [(9-8)^2 + (8-8)^2 + (9-8)^2 +(5-8)^2 +(9-8)^2]/5

=( 1+ 0 + 1 +9 +1)/5

= 12/5

variance (σ2)= 12/5

=2.4
